linux搭建文件服务器实现上传与下载,文件上传到linux服务器
文章结构
描述在日常开发场景中,文件经常在远程服务器和本地服务器之间传输。博文主要介绍了如何基于远程访问软件(如SecureCRT、PuTTY)通过Linux命令上传/下载文件。实施模式1基于SSH文件传输协议,PSCP软件
场景 1.1:
。
本地上传
(Windows)上传CLI pscp.exe-l server _ name-pw server _ pwd-P 22 local _ file server _ IP:Upload _ path举例 1.1
C: Users k engines Desktop pscppscp.exe-l root-pw 12345678-P 22 C: pscp test . txt 192 . 168 . 182 . 131:/home/pscp/场景 1.2:
远程下载
(Linux)下载CLI pscp.exe-l server _ name-pw server _ pwd-P 22 server _ IP:file _ path local _ path举例 1.2
C: Users k engines Desktop pscppscp . exe-LRoot-pw 12345678-P22 192 . 168 . 182 . 131:/home/pscp/test . txt C: pscp 2基于SSH文件传输协议,
场景 2.1:
(Windows)在SecureCRT终端仿真器中输入“rz”命令,在弹出窗口中选择文件,用Zmodem将文件上传到服务器。执行进程[root @ localhost pscp]# rzrrz等待接收. zmodem TRL c100 % 2kb 2 kb/s00:00:01 0错误[root @ localhost pscp]# ll total 4-rw-r-. 1 root root 2587 2017年7月7日ipython _ log
本地上传
场景 2.2:
(Linux)在SecureCRT终端模拟器中执行“sz file_name”命令,将文件下载到本地(无弹出窗口)。执行过程[root @ localhost pscp]# szipython _ log . pyrz zmodem TRL c100 % 2kb 2kb/s00:00:01 0错误securecrt上传/下载路径
选项(o)会话选项x/y/zmodem
基于SFTP文件传输协议的SecureCRT软件的实现过程
在SecureCRT终端模拟器中输入“Alt P”,进入ftp操作,通过“put/get”命令完成文件的上传和下载。命令FTP help:列出FTP提供的所有命令pwd:显示linux主机所在的目录(即远程主机目录)Lpwd:显示本地目录ls:显示linux主机当前目录的文件信息lls:显示当前本地上传目录中有哪些文件lcd:切换本地上传目录路径cd:切换远程上传目录路径get:从远程目录下载文件到本地目录put:从本地目录上传文件到远程主机(linux)quit:断开FTP连接效果显示
从LINKS Linux系统到windows系统Xmodem,Ymodem,Zmodem
远程下载
的SSH实现方法如何将linux系统SSH到windows系统,分析如何通过终端将本地文件上传到linux服务器或从linux主机下载文件到本地,使用SecureCRT在linux和Windows之间传输文件。